**Ticket: Config drift on BounceSift processor**

The email bounce processor in the Larkfield environment has drifted from the values committed in the release branch. Retry windows and suppression thresholds no longer match, which likely explains the duplicate suppression entries reported Tuesday. Please reconcile before the Thursday cut. For reference, the currently deployed configuration on the live node reads as follows.

config for yajep-yahof:
[briax]
port = 9200
region = outer-2
host = briax.nelvrocorp.test
team = raleth
timeout_ms = 1500
retries = 1

Plugins occasionally see NXDOMAIN for internal service names even though the records exist. Root cause is a stale negative-cache entry in the sandbox resolver after a zone rotation. If your plugin logs resolution failures lasting under two minutes, retry with exponential backoff rather than failing hard. Persistent failures mean the resolver pod missed the rotation signal; flush its cache and re-run your health probe. When reporting, always include the identifier below.

pipeline stamp: htk3_69f

Ticket #— Floor 9 Opening Prep, Brindlemoor House

Hi facilities folks, Floor 9 opens to staff next Monday and we need a few things squared away before then. Lift access is live, but the two side doors by the kitchenette are still on the old lock config — please reprogram them before Friday. Also, signage for the quiet rooms hasn't arrived, so pop up the temporary printed ones for now. Until the badge readers sync, the interim door code for Floor 9 is below.

door code, bajop-bajog: bdg-DSWAC-43621